Mental Health Initiative for Children & Adolescents at the Alberta Childrens Hospital and Stollery Children’s Hosptial.

In 2020-21, Avery’s Foundation raised over $140K for mental health support at the two main Alberta Hospitals.

This cause was important to us due to the tremendous impact it has on children’s mental health as shown in the Stollery’s own data:


– 70 per cent of mental health problems begin in childhood and adolescence
– Mental health affects one in two Canadians by age 40
– Half of those with chronic disorders show symptoms by age 14

In 2020, Stollery Children’s Hospital Foundation committed to raise $6.5M over five years to bring integrated, clinical mental health services to the Stollery Children’s Hospital. support and commitment has helped the integrated mental health services within the emergency department to boost helpline support to be 24/7, along with other improvements including building a separate walk-in clinic space to help to increase timely access to an expert team of nurses, social workers, therapists, and child and adolescent psychiatrists.
